The Pictogrel thumbnail queue accepts image-processing jobs via POST /v1/thumbs. Each job specifies a source asset, target sizes, and an optional crop strategy. Jobs are processed in FIFO order per tenant; expect completion within two minutes under normal load. Status is available at GET /v1/thumbs/{job}. All requests must be authenticated — unauthenticated calls return 401 without a body. New team members should use the shared staging credentials until issued their own. Include in the Authorization header the bearer token below.

session JWT of yawep-yawep = eyJhbGciOiJIUzI1NiIsInR5cCI6IkpXVCJ9.eyJzdWIiOiI3pWF3_In0.aXYsHiog

Ticket #4: Contractor onboarding, week one. The contractor assigned to the Larkspur Annex refit will work Monday to Friday, arriving via the east entrance. New starters should note that contractors sign in daily at the Holt Street desk and are escorted until their access is confirmed. Parking is in Bay C only. For the first week the contractor will use the temporary pass below.

staff pass of yagep-tajep = bdg-TRT-1

Vendor note: Graywick Analytics owns the static-analysis baseline file for the Corvid pipeline. Do not edit baseline.yml manually; regenerated baselines must come from Graywick's tooling or the scan gate will fail every build. If a customer reports blocked merges citing baseline drift, collect the scan ID and build number, then open a ticket on their portal. For anything urgent or ambiguous, reach the Graywick vendor liaison directly at the address below.

escalation mailbox, bafog-fafog: ulador@paliqlabs.internal

Subject: Tilefetch prefetcher v2 is out

Hi all — the Tilefetch map-tile prefetcher v2 just went to prod. Main change: it now warms tiles along predicted routes instead of a fixed radius, so cache hit rates should jump. If you're debugging prefetch behavior later, everything is keyed off the build token below.

pipeline stamp: htk31_f769b577b3028a4e9958e5bb8d1259a